Ok. I've did what you told and used the DRM PPA. Here we go:
Boot went fine and I've seen splash too.

1) It got stuck just before the login screen with the message, printed on the 
screen, "[drm:radeon_cs_ioctl] *ERROR* Failed to parse relocation !". I pressed 
enter a few times and got the login panel;
2) Once on the desktop I've tried to launch some application but none of them 
had border or top bar. They all started located at the top left of the screen;
3) Crash-handler application started whining about nautilus and an 
applet-indicator crashes. Repeatedly.

I add the logs of this stuff. Most of error messages are located in
syslog. They're easy to find, just look for the word "error".
